Why Individuals and Corporations Seek Email Hacking Services
The term “hacking” often carries an unfavorable undertone, yet it fundamentally refers to the competent manipulation of computer systems. Ethical hackers, or “White Hats,” utilize these abilities to fix issues instead of create them. There are numerous professional circumstances where working with a hacker is not just beneficial but needed.
1. Account Recovery and Data Retrieval
The most typical factor for seeking expert support is the loss of account gain access to. In spite of the existence of “Forgot Password” functions, advanced security procedures like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A) can often lock legal owners out of their own accounts if they lose access to their secondary gadgets.
2. Digital Forensics and Legal Investigations
In legal disagreements or corporate investigations, it may be essential to retrieve deleted emails or determine the origin of a destructive message. Professional hackers trained in digital forensics can trace IP addresses and take a look at metadata to supply evidence for legal proceedings.
3. Penetration Testing for Enterprises
Big organizations hire ethical hackers to attempt to breach their own email servers. This proactive approach identifies vulnerabilities before a harmful star can exploit them, guaranteeing that exclusive details remains protected.

The legal structure surrounding e-mail access is governed by acts such as the Computer Fraud and Abuse Act (CFAA) in the United States and the GDPR in Europe. Hiring someone to access an account that does not belong to the hirer is a federal offense in lots of jurisdictions.
Authorized Access: Hiring a professional to recover your own account or a business account you manage is legal.Unapproved Access: Hiring someone to spy on a spouse, a worker, or a competitor is illegal and can lead to jail time and heavy fines.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Is it legal to hire a hacker to recuperate my own email?
Yes, it is legal to hire a professional to help you in accessing an account that you legally own. This is thought about a service for data healing.

3. Can a hacker recover e-mails that were erased years ago?
It depends upon the email service provider’s data retention policy. While a hacker can often find traces of deleted data in regional device backups or server caches, if the data has actually been overwritten on the service provider’s physical servers, it may be permanently unrecoverable.
4. What is the difference in between a password cracker and an ethical hacker?
A password cracker is a tool or a private focused entirely on bypassing alphanumeric security. An ethical hacker is a broad specialist who takes a look at the whole security environment, consisting of network vulnerabilities, human elements, and software bugs.
5. How can I safeguard my email so I never need to hire a hacker?
The very best defense consists of using a robust password manager, enabling hardware-based MFA (like a YubiKey), and being vigilant against phishing attempts. Regularly auditing your account’s “active sessions” is also an essential practice.
